IND vs NZ 2023 ODI:Team India started the New Year on a triumphant note by defeating Sri Lanka in both T20I and ODI matches. After defeating Sri Lanka in the fifty-over format, India will be looking to keep up its winning streak against New Zealand in white-ball cricket. India and New Zealand will compete against one another in three ODIs and three T20Is. Beginning on January 18, New Zealand will embark on a tour of India.

 

In the T20I series against New Zealand, India will be captained by Hardik Pandya. For the ODIs against New Zealand, Team India’s captain will be Rohit Sharma. Meanwhile, the Kiwis will enter the series with an ODI victory over Pakistan. As the Indian cricket team gets ready to play New Zealand in white-ball cricket, it’s time to analyse every element of the T20I and ODI series.

IND vs NZ 2023 ODI and T20I series Full Schedule

 

ODI Series

Jan 18, Wed – India vs New Zealand, 1st ODI – Hyderabad – 1:30 PM

Jan 21, Sat – India vs New Zealand, 2nd ODI – Raipur – 1:30 PM

Jan 24, Tue – India vs New Zealand, 3rd ODI – Indore – 1:30 PM

T20I Series

Jan 27, Fri – India vs New Zealand, 1st T20I – Ranchi – 7:00 PM

Jan 29, Sun – India vs New Zealand, 2nd T20I – Lucknow – 7:00 PM

Feb 01, Wed – India vs New Zealand, 3rd T20I – Ahmedabad – 7:00 PM

IND vs NZ ODI and T20I series Live Telecast and Streaming Details

The T20I and ODI matches will be broadcast on the Star Sports Network. The matches will also be streamed live on the Disney+ Hotstar app and website.

Full Squads

India’s ODI squad: Rohit Sharma (c), Shubman Gill, Ishan Kishan, Virat Kohli, Shreyas Iyer, Suryakumar Yadav, KS Bharat (wk), Hardik Pandya (vc), Washington Sundar, Shahbaz Ahmed, Shardul Thakur, Yuzvendra Chahal, Kuldeep Yadav, Mohammad Shami, Mohammed Siraj, Umran Malik

New Zealand’s ODI squad: Tom Latham (c), Finn Allen, Michael Bracewell, Devon Conway, Lockie Ferguson, Matt Henry, Adam Milne, Daryl Mitchell, Henry Nicholls, Glenn Phillips, Mitchell Santner, Henry Shipley, Ish Sodhi

India’s T20I squad: Hardik Pandya (c), Suryakumar Yadav (vc), Ishan Kishan (wk), R Gaikwad, Shubman Gill, Deepak Hooda, Rahul Tripathi, Jitesh Sharma (wk), Washington Sundar, Kuldeep Yadav, Yuzvendra Chahal, Arshdeep Singh, Umran Malik, Shivam Mavi, Prithvi Shaw, Mukesh Kumar

New Zealand’s T20I squad: Mitchell Santner (c), Finn Allen, Michael Bracewell, Mark Chapman, Dane Cleaver, Devon Conway, Jacob Duffy, Lockie Ferguson, Ben Lister, Daryl Mitchell, Glenn Phillips, Michael Rippon, Henry Shipley, Ish Sodhi, Blair Tickner
